# Relevance Tuning Notes — Querymere

Provenance for ranking changes. BM25 weights, synonym maps, and boost curves live in `relevance.toml`, versioned per deploy. Every tuning change must cite the offline eval run and the A/B gate result. No hand-edits on prod indexes. Rollback means redeploying the prior config, not patching weights live. Eval artifacts are archived for ninety days. The config hash for the current ranking bundle follows.

trace token, fafog-kageg: htk4_98e6

☐ Ceremony step 7 — Tailspool CLI signing key. Tailspool is our internal CLI for tailing service logs; its release binaries must be signed during this ceremony. Contractor duties: witness the signing, verify the checksum read-back, and initial the paper log. Do not plug personal devices into the air-gapped workstation. If the signing key material fails to load, abort and notify the ceremony lead. Unlocking the backup key shard reader requires the passphrase that follows.

unlock words, yadup-yagef: zorael-druix

Runbook: Hot-reloading Ferngate config

Support can trigger a config hot-reload on the Ferngate gateway without a restart. Send SIGHUP to the supervisor, then confirm the reload line in the service log within ten seconds. If the log shows a parse error, the old config stays active — escalate rather than retrying. Always include the running build token, shown below, in the ticket.

session token of tajef-bageg = htk21_5d90d574934f3ccae6437

Q3 Planning Note — Lease Renegotiation

Sales leads: the Drelmont Plaza lease is up for renewal. We are pushing for a 12% rate cut and a shorter term. Expect possible desk reshuffles in October. Do not discuss terms with the landlord's reps. Context on why this matters to our roadmap follows below.

internal memo for tawif-hahig: Headcount on the Silwyn team goes from 52 to 82 by the end of December. Gross margin on Silwyn came in at 61 percent against a plan of 28 percent.